Description

With the possibility of utilizing a triple-bandpass filter to pass green, red, and NIR to a Bayer filter-coated VNIR image sensor, it is necessary to develop an algorithm for accurately taking out NIR information from red and green pixels, whilst also adding NIR information back to these pixels for the final image. This is necessary for studying the scientific usefulness of this filtering technique that Connor has come up with, which will aid in both the VNIR test plan and the band feasibility document. The deliverable is a logical algorithm (possibly implemented in a script) for being able to both read out individual red, green, and NIR information, in addition to reading out a smooth image, where each pixel contains some red, green, and NIR info.
